YORK JAYCEES ANNUAL CHILI COOK-OFF COMING TO SOVEREIGN BANK STADIUM
Monday, April 6, 2009
Revolution Teaming Up With Non-profit Group, Bringing Yearly Tradition To Ballpark
As part of the York Revolution’s continuing efforts to help non-profit groups and expand their involvement in the York Community, the Revolution have now teamed up with the York Jaycees to bring the Jaycees’ annual Chili Cook-Off to Sovereign Bank Stadium. The event will be held Saturday, May 23 on the Brooks Robinson Plaza from noon until 5pm.
The York Jaycees Chili Cook-Off is a major fundraising project that directly and immediately benefits the York Community, with proceeds going to charities designated by the participating teams. More than 30 teams participated in 2008, and 2009 marks the 21st anniversary of the event.
The event is always a hit with local companies, who can enter teams into the corporate category, but anyone may put a team together to raise money for their favorite charity. Some of the teams also participate in an additional competition sponsored by Chili Appreciation Society International, with separate judging and awards.
The prize money won by teams along with part of the admission cost goes toward the charities of the teams’ choosing. Money raised by the Jaycees goes into the Jaycees’ grant fund that local organizations apply for.
“The Jaycees are looking forward to holding our annual Chili Cook-Off at Sovereign Bank Stadium this year,” said York Jaycees President Zach Zimmerman. “This has become a premier event for York and a wonderful benefit to local community organizations. With this partnership, the Cook-Off can only grow and have continued success.”
The event is one of two major Jaycees fundraisers, which helps the Jaycees give in excess of $15,000 back to the community each year.
“We’re excited to host such a well-respected, well-attended fundraising event like the Jaycees Chili Cook-Off here at Sovereign Bank Stadium,” said Revolution assistant general manager Neil Fortier. “It will be exciting to see who will claim 2009 bragging rights!”
The York Jaycees is a not-for-profit, leadership training organization that focuses on community service. It is open to all young men and women, ages 21 to 40, residing in the greater York, Pennsylvania area. It is a chapter of the Pennsylvania Jaycees, the United States Junior Chamber of Commerce and Junior Chamber International (JCI), a global organization.
